Output 953da476f92fee27f491f090f8276b21ed6d9f8683b9d91a76fd145c759118e6:1

value
6584886
script pubkey
OP_0 OP_PUSHBYTES_20 6f14da70f27bbb171af91994d7633770832b9a1c
address
bc1qdu2d5u8j0wa3wxherx2dwcehwzpjhxsudgj44l
transaction
953da476f92fee27f491f090f8276b21ed6d9f8683b9d91a76fd145c759118e6
spent
true